Suicide is the second leading cause of death in individuals between the ages of 10-34 in the United States. While the connection to the gut microbiota, immunity, and intestinal permeability has garnered increasing attention, our understanding of the role of oral flora in the systemic pathophysiology of depression is limited and, to our knowledge, links with suicidal ideation (SI) have not yet been explored in human populations. Emerging literature suggests that the oral microbiome may be leveraged for treatment and diagnosis of oral as well as systemic disease. Salivary microbiota and major histocompatibility complex (MHC) human leukocyte antigen (HLA) alleles were compared between 47 (12.6%) young adults with recent SI and 325 (87.4%) controls without recent SI. Several bacterial taxa were correlated with SI after controlling for sleep issues, diet, and genetics. To our knowledge, this is the first study to demonstrate a role for HLA genetics in SI and the potential for genetic and salivary bacterial interactions in the etiology of suicide.
